Origins of the Palandjian Surname

The origins of the Palandjian surname can be traced back to the country of Armenia. The name is believed to be of Armenian origin, derived from the word 'Palandj,' which means 'silk merchant' in Armenian. The Palandjians were known for their expertise in the silk trade, and their surname became associated with this profession.

United States

In the United States, the Palandjian surname has a significant presence, with a incidence rate of 72. This indicates that there are a substantial number of individuals with the Palandjian surname living in the US. Many Armenian immigrants brought the Palandjian surname to the US, where it has become established and recognized in American society.

Nations with additional Palandjian on the planet

  1. United States United States (72)
  2. France France (53)
  3. Canada Canada (13)
  4. Australia Australia (5)
  5. Greece Greece (5)
  6. Denmark Denmark (4)
  7. Finland Finland (3)
  8. Spain Spain (2)
  9. Cyprus Cyprus (1)
  10. Italy Italy (1)
  11. Russia Russia (1)
